The Fair Trade Towns story began in Lancashire in 2000 when Garstang declared itself to be a Fair Trade Town. Now there are over 2000 fair trade communities around the world on every continent. The UK has almost 400 fair trade communities.
​
The International Fair Trade Towns Conference happens every autumn in a fair trade city somewhere around the world. Recent hosts have included Quito in Ecuador, Bristol and Cardiff with future hosts including Cape Town.
